Sun-Powered Rooftop Solutions
What methods allow homeowners to effectively capture solar power while improving their roof structures? Solar-enhanced roofing options present a persuasive response. These innovative systems combine traditional roofing materials with photovoltaic technology, enabling property owners to produce power while preserving visual attractiveness. By installing solar-powered shingles or tile systems, homeowners can seamlessly integrate solar power generation into their roofs, maximizing energy efficiency while maintaining the architectural integrity of their homes.
Such systems not only reduce reliance on fossil fuels but also cut utility expenses. In addition, innovations in solar technology have resulted in more durable, weather-resistant materials that can withstand challenging conditions, ensuring longevity. As energy requirements grow, solar-integrated roofs provide an efficient, sustainable alternative that matches modern ecological goals. This dual functionality enhances home value and advances environmental stewardship, positioning homeowners as proactive contributors in the renewable energy movement. Ultimately, this innovative approach transforms traditional roofing into an essential component of energy sustainability.

Sustainable Material Choices
As property owners continue to focus on eco-conscious choices, numerous eco-friendly roofing materials have emerged as practical alternatives. Among these, reclaimed wood presents a rustic aesthetic while minimizing waste, making it a favored option. Metal roofing, particularly made from recycled materials, features longevity and recyclability, substantially reducing environmental impact. In addition, natural slate and clay tiles provide resilience and reduced energy consumption, often obtained via sustainable practices. Green roofs, which feature vegetation, improve insulation and foster biodiversity. Additionally, synthetic materials manufactured from recycled content can imitate traditional roofing styles while being more lightweight and durable. These sustainable options not only address the pressing demand for eco-friendly construction but also cater to the aesthetic and functional expectations of modern homes.

Energy-Efficient Roof Coatings
Whereas traditional roofing materials typically absorb heat, energy-efficient roof coatings, commonly referred to as cool roof technologies, reflect a significant portion of sunlight and minimize heat retention. These coatings are generally composed of reflective pigments and specialized polymers that enhance their thermal performance. By decreasing heat transfer, energy-efficient roof coatings can reduce indoor temperatures, resulting in decreased reliance on air conditioning systems. This not only promotes energy savings but also contributes to reduced greenhouse gas emissions. Furthermore, these coatings can increase the lifespan of roofing materials by safeguarding them from UV damage and weathering. In summary, energy-efficient roof coatings represent a sustainable solution that benefits both property owners and the environment, making them an increasingly popular choice in modern roofing practices.
Heat-Reflective Roof Products
Reflective roofing materials, often categorized under cool roof technologies, play an essential role in enhancing energy efficiency in buildings. These products are engineered to deflect a substantial amount of solar radiation from the building, minimizing heat intake and decreasing interior temperatures. By utilizing reflective applications, membranes, or shingles, facility managers can diminish their need for climate control equipment, generating considerable energy conservation. Furthermore, these roofing solutions help reduce urban heat island phenomena, fostering lower temperatures in highly populated regions. Offered in multiple hues and surface treatments, reflective roofing materials can be visually attractive while delivering practical advantages. As awareness of climate change grows, the adoption of reflective roofing materials is increasingly recognized as a sustainable choice for modern construction practices.

Synthetic Roofing Products
What makes synthetic roofing solutions a compelling choice for current construction? These innovative materials provide a combination of resilience, aesthetic charm, and value. Constructed with different polymers and composites, synthetic roofing solutions replicate conventional materials like slate or wood as they delivering improved performance features. They are light in weight, which eases installation and minimizes structural load on buildings.
In addition, synthetic solutions frequently provide excellent resistance to weather elements, including UV rays, moisture, and extreme temperatures, guaranteeing durability and minimal maintenance requirements. Many products also offer warranties that indicate their reliability and performance.
Concerning environmental impact, synthetic roofing materials can be created with recycled content, advancing sustainability efforts within the construction industry. Their versatility provides a variety of styles and colors, accommodating diverse architectural designs. In general, synthetic roofing products offer an attractive alternative for homeowners and builders pursuing modern solutions.
Sophisticated Deployment Methods
Numerous advanced installation strategies have emerged in the roofing industry, significantly improving the efficiency and efficacy of the process. One remarkable method is the use of prefabricated roofing systems, which enable for speedier assembly on-site and reduce material waste. In addition, modular roofing panels allow for easier handling and installation, resulting in considerable time savings.
An additional cutting-edge technique includes the application of advanced adhesive technologies, which do away with the need for mechanical fasteners in specific roofing applications, consequently streamlining the installation process. The use of drones for site inspections and measurements has also gained popularity, providing accurate data and improving safety during the installation phase.
Moreover, training programs for roofing professionals now highlight precision techniques, such as correct flashing installation and thermal imaging assessments, to provide long-lasting results. These modern installation methods lead to improved overall roof efficiency and longevity, demonstrating the industry's dedication to continuous improvement.
Intelligent Roof Technology and Systems
Advanced roofing systems and technology are transforming the way buildings handle energy and environmental conditions. These innovative solutions combine sensors, automation, and state-of-the-art materials to enhance roof performance. Built with real-time monitoring capabilities, smart roofs can track temperature, humidity, and energy consumption, enabling efficient management of heating and cooling systems.
Additionally, several smart roofs utilize green or reflective materials that boost energy efficiency by decreasing heat related resource absorption and encouraging insulation. Various systems even integrate solar panels that generate renewable energy, additionally promoting sustainability efforts.
Moreover, state-of-the-art smart roofing technologies can inform building managers to potential complications, such as leaks or structural weaknesses, facilitating timely maintenance. As urban environments increasingly address climate challenges, these solutions not only boost building resilience but also support a reduction in overall carbon footprints, making them an essential component of modern architectural practices.

What Is the Expected Durability of Today's Roofing Materials?
The typical lifespan of modern roofing materials varies significantly, commonly ranging from 15 to 50 years. Asphalt shingles generally last about 20 years, while metal roof systems can endure up to 50 years with appropriate upkeep and professional installation.

What Are the Financial Requirements for Innovative Roofing Solutions?
Costs connected to innovative roofing solutions fluctuate substantially, usually extending from $5 to $15 per square foot. Elements affecting pricing include materials, installation complexity, and local workforce costs, affecting overall project budgets significantly.
